Technology Advances Favor DIY Installers: Solar panel efficiency has dramatically improved with monocrystalline panels now achieving 20-24% efficiency ratings, while polycrystalline panels are no longer in production as of 2023. Solar panels capture sunlight and convert it into electricity. Inverters change this electricity from direct current (DC) to alternating current (AC), which homes use. Mounting racks secure the panels on roofs or other structures.

Switching Frequency: Low-frequency inverters operate closer to the line frequency, while high-frequency inverters operate at much higher frequencies, affecting various other parameters like filter size and efficiency. The switching frequencies for these inverters typically range from 100 Hz. .
